The Echibeckia 'Summerina Firana' is a striking perennial that combines the best traits of both echinacea and rudbeckia. This unique hybrid features vibrant orange multi-colored blooms that create a stunning display throughout the summer months. The petals have a rich, warm hue that attracts pollinators, making it a beneficial addition to any garden.
With a compact growth habit, this variety reaches a height of approximately 18-24 inches, making it suitable for borders, containers, or as a standalone feature. The sturdy stems are resilient, ensuring that the flowers maintain their upright position even in windy conditions.
Bloom Time: The 'Summerina Firana' typically begins to bloom in mid-summer and continues to produce flowers until the first frost, providing a long-lasting burst of color. Each flower head is large and prominent, making it a focal point in any landscape.
This perennial is also known for its adaptability. It thrives in a range of soil types, from well-drained sandy soils to heavier clay. It prefers full sun but can tolerate partial shade, making it versatile for various garden settings.
In addition to its aesthetic appeal, the Echibeckia 'Summerina Firana' is relatively low-maintenance. Once established, it requires minimal watering, making it a practical choice for gardeners looking for beautiful yet easy-to-care-for plants.
